Data collected from various shopper safety businesses indicate the alarming rise of on-line lotto scams. In a recent survey, approximately 24% of respondents reported receiving unsolicited messages claiming they had received a lottery or sweepstakes prize. Additionally, victims of these scams reported a mean monetary loss of almost $1,000, while some individuals misplaced upwards of $10,000. The FTC noted that victims aged 18 to 34 had been among the many most targeted demographic, as they're typically extra partaking with digital platforms.

Numerous people have unfortunately found themselves ensnared in online lotto scams, leading to significant monetary losses. One notable case involved a lady in her late fifties who obtained an e mail claiming she had gained $5 million from a lottery she by no means entered. The e-mail instructed her to wire $1,500 to say her winnings. After complying, she discovered the truth: it was a scam, and her cash was misplaced. This case exemplifies how easily the promise of enormous cash prizes can result in distressing outcomes.
At its core, Lotto Prediction is a recreation of probability the place players select a set of numbers from a predefined range. Depending on the particular lottery guidelines, gamers usually need to match their chosen numbers to those drawn at random. Popular lotteries, like Powerball and Mega Millions, have specific structures—typically, a participant must choose five numbers from a pool that may range from 1 to sixty nine, plus one extra quantity from a special set. This simple premise leads to complicated calculations regarding the probability of profitable lotto. For instance, in a major lottery, the percentages can attain as excessive as 1 in tens of millions. To understand how these odds are derived, one should contemplate combinatorial arithmetic, which plays a vital position in calculating attainable outcomes.

Understanding the psychological factors that lead people to fall for on-line lotto scams is significant. Many victims are motivated by the hope of monetary gain. The attract of winning a big sum of money can cloud judgment and override instinctual skepticism. Scammers exploit these feelings by presenting situations that are designed to seem virtually too good to be true, but with convincing particulars.
